JOB TITLE: Clinical Technologist
CLASS CODE: 000503
JOB SUMMARY
Conduct and interpret tests and procedures in a clinical laboratory.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ILTIES
Using sterile technique set up appropriate blood and bone marrow cultures.
Using appropriate additives, perform routine and specialized harvests, prepare slides.
Using routine and specialized staining techniques, prepare stained slides for analysis.
Perform routine, extended and specialized microscope analyses of chromosomes. Document and summarize analyses.
Prepare photomicrographs or computer images of chromosomes suitable for karyotyping.
Prepare correctly arranged karyotypes suitable for comparison of homologues and demonstration of any existing abnormalities.
Prepare reagents; keep records and quality control data as needed.
KNOWLEDGE, TRAINING & SKILLS
Bachelor's degree with major in science
EXPERIENCE
Two years of related experience. An equivalent combination of education, training and/or experience may be substituted for the requirements noted.
